Adenofibrocarcinoma of the ovary is quite rare. Although 17 cases have been mentioned in the literature, some of which may reflect different entities since clinical and pathologic discussions with followup have been found only in a few isolated instances. We have reported 4 patients who showed atypical and frankly carcinomatous changes involving the glandular epithelium of adenofibromas. In none was there evidence of metastasis or local spread. This neoplasm is frequently asymptomatic, growing quite large before discovery.
